Domestic markets staged a notable recovery today, with the Sensex surging more than 300 points to cross the 76,900 mark. The Nifty 50 followed a similar upward trajectory, hovering near the psychological 24,000 threshold as trading activity intensified during the weekly expiry.
The shift in sentiment follows a brief dip in US Treasury yields, which provided much-needed relief to global equities. Midcap and smallcap segments also joined the rally, suggesting a broader base of participation across the Indian exchanges after yesterday’s pullback.
Why caution remains: Despite the intraday gains, market analysts advise investors to remain vigilant. High valuations and volatile macroeconomic indicators mean the current momentum could face resistance as traders monitor global interest rate signals and geopolitical developments closely.
